BV65 ZSL is a 2015 Kia Sportage in Silver with a 1,591c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 9 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 88.9%.
Across all 2015 Kia Sportage models, the average MOT pass rate is 81.4% with a typical mileage of 53,274 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Kia Sportage fails its MOT is brake pad(s) less than 1.5 mm thick, accounting for 16,003 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BV65 ZSL,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Kia Sportage typically stays on UK roads for around 26 years. At 11 years old, this Kia Sportage is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
